## Pick-list optimizer: tuning

For the Brackenfield rollout, the optimizer batches orders before
solving routes, so release timing matters — a deploy mid-batch just
requeues cleanly, no drama. Walking-distance weights were recalibrated
after the mezzanine expansion. Don't ship a config change without
rerunning the sim harness. The values going out in this release are:

tuning table, yajog-yahof:
BUDGETS = {
    "lamvan": 303,
    "wenox": 460,
    "fenvan": 525,
}

Hi Torvald — handing over the ORM refactor on Glasswing before I'm out. Short version for plugin authors: the legacy Mapletide ORM layer is being split into a query core and an adapter shell, so plugins should target the adapter interface only. Old model hooks still work but log deprecation warnings; we'll keep them alive two more releases. Docs for the new interface live in the plugin portal. To unlock the maintainer sandbox and test your adapter, use the passphrase below.

recovery phrase for tajop-kawep: belox-joreth-ulaox-novael

Changed defaults in Splitfork, our assignment service. Bucketing now uses sticky hashing per account instead of per session, and the holdout slice grew from 2% to 5%. Callers relying on session-level reassignment must opt in explicitly. Review the diff against the new baseline; the updated default configuration is listed below.

config for tagep-kajof:
[casir]
port = 6379
region = south-1
host = casir.paliqdyn.example
team = tamax
timeout_ms = 250
retries = 2

Subject: Turnstile counter cut-over done

Cut-over of the Gatewick turnstile counter finished last night before the Harrowfield match. Old aggregator is decommissioned; counts now flow straight from the lane controllers to the new tally service. No data loss observed during the switch window. Dashboards were repointed this morning. For anyone maintaining this later, the live settings we cut over to are below.

config for kagup-hahig:
druwyn:
  pin: 2801
  metrics_host: metrics.druwyn.zemvarlabs.internal
  tenant: sorius
  seal: seal_798a43d7